
One more step along golden path,
One more time you pray in faith.
With a breeze sky turns grey,
In the creek time slipped away.
Taking a breath in the silent sound,
warming your chest like days we passed.
Seeking the light before darkness fall,
touching your cheeks for a hard farewell.
From now on I will watch you from afar,
In the night when you find a flashing star.
My heart will lead you in all seasons,
in your journey on the road to horzion.
